Classic Pumpkin Spice Latte

This iconic autumn latte balances espresso, pumpkin, and warm spices for a comforting seasonal beverage.

Ingredients

240 ml milk of choice
30 ml pumpkin puree
1 teaspoon pumpkin pie spice
15 ml maple syrup or sugar
1 shot (30 ml) espresso or 60 ml strong brewed coffee
Whipped cream (optional)

Instructions

  1. In a small saucepan, combine pumpkin puree, pumpkin pie spice, and maple syrup. Heat gently for 1–2 minutes while stirring.
  2. Add milk and warm until hot but not boiling. Froth with a whisk, milk frother, or immersion blender for creamy texture.
  3. Pour espresso into a mug. Add the pumpkin milk mixture and stir to combine.
  4. Top with whipped cream and a light sprinkle of pumpkin pie spice. Serve immediately.

Cinnamon Maple Latte

A subtly sweet latte infused with cinnamon and maple syrup for a warm, nutty flavor.

Ingredients

240 ml milk of choice
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
15 ml maple syrup
1 shot espresso or 60 ml strong brewed coffee
Cinnamon stick for garnish (optional)

Instructions

  1. Heat milk and cinnamon together in a small saucepan, whisking to combine.
  2. Froth the mixture until it becomes creamy and lightly foamy.
  3. Pour espresso into a mug, then slowly add the frothed milk.
  4. Stir in maple syrup to taste. Garnish with a cinnamon stick or a light dusting of cinnamon powder.

Chai-Spiced Latte

Chai spices bring a fragrant, warming twist to your autumn latte, perfect for chilly afternoons.

Ingredients

240 ml milk of choice
1 chai tea bag or 1 teaspoon loose chai tea
15 ml honey or maple syrup
Pinch of nutmeg and cinnamon
1 shot espresso (optional for extra caffeine)

Instructions

  1. Heat milk in a saucepan until warm, then steep the chai tea for 3–5 minutes.
  2. Remove the tea bag or strain loose tea. Add honey and spices, whisking to combine.
  3. For a spiked version, add espresso. Froth the mixture for a creamy finish.
  4. Pour into a mug and sprinkle a pinch of cinnamon or nutmeg on top before serving.

Caramel Pecan Latte

This latte combines nutty and sweet flavors for a rich, autumn-inspired drink.

Ingredients

240 ml milk of choice
15 ml caramel sauce
10 grams toasted pecans, finely chopped
1 shot espresso or 60 ml strong brewed coffee
Whipped cream (optional)

Instructions

  1. Warm milk and caramel sauce in a small saucepan until hot. Froth until creamy.
  2. Pour espresso into a mug, then add the milk and caramel mixture.
  3. Top with whipped cream and sprinkle finely chopped pecans on top for crunch and aroma.

Apple Cinnamon Latte

A fruity autumn latte with the warmth of cinnamon and the sweetness of apple for a seasonal twist.

Ingredients

240 ml milk of choice
60 ml apple juice or apple cider
½ teaspoon ground cinnamon
15 ml honey
1 shot espresso (optional)

Instructions

  1. Heat milk, apple juice, cinnamon, and honey in a saucepan until warm. Whisk until frothy.
  2. Pour espresso into a mug if desired, then add the apple milk mixture.
  3. Garnish with a light sprinkle of cinnamon or thin apple slices for presentation.
